org.siebengeisslein.persistent
Class PString

java.lang.Object
  extended by org.siebengeisslein.client.Persistent
      extended by org.siebengeisslein.client.Immutable
          extended by org.siebengeisslein.persistent.PString
All Implemented Interfaces:
java.lang.Cloneable, java.lang.Comparable<PString>, CloneAndMergeAware, CloneAware, Instrumented, MergeAware

public class PString
extends Immutable
implements java.lang.Comparable<PString>


Constructor Summary
PString()
           
PString(java.lang.String value)
           
 
Method Summary
 int compareTo(PString pstring)
           
 boolean equals(java.lang.Object object)
           
 int hashCode()
           
 java.lang.String toString()
           
 
Methods inherited from class org.siebengeisslein.client.Immutable
clone, getComponentId, merge, replaceMerged
 
Methods inherited from class org.siebengeisslein.client.Persistent
abort, clearUserLocals, clone, commit, disposeTransient, getGroup, getRef, getTransientValue, initTransient, isWriteTransaction, joinWriteTransaction, readLock, setGroup, setTransientValue, toPersistent, toRef, writeExternal, writeLock
 
Methods inherited from class java.lang.Object
fin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

PString

public PString(java.lang.String value)

PString

public PString()
Method Detail

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

equals

public boolean equals(java.lang.Object object)
Overrides:
equals in class java.lang.Object

hashCode

public int hashCode()
Overrides:
hashCode in class Persistent

compareTo

public int compareTo(PString pstring)
Specified by:
compareTo in interface java.lang.Comparable<PString>